Resumo: The purpose of this work is to measure and establish the benefits of the Wavelet Transform (WT) , using the DNAx pulses as mother wavelets at the patterns recognition in ECG signals. It was used 50 patients divided in 9 different pathological groups, and one more group of health patients. Only one cardiac cycle from the lead I was used as a reference for each of the patient. At the first test, time correlation was used to measure the similarity between the cardiac cycles of the group of patients with Myocardial Infarction anterior, and after between this group and every group of this work. On the second test, the similarity was estimated using the bi-dimensional cross correlation between the WT coefficients of the cardiac cycles. The transformations were calculated using the two traditional wavelets and others obtained by a technique called DNAx created and patentiated by Caputo. The test comparison showed that, in almost the totality of the cases, the WT associated to the DNAx pulse obtained good results, and in some cases better than the traditional functions.
